Allow Power Query Applied Steps Rename command before applied step has refreshed

After I create a new step, I want to be able to rename the step to document the purpose of the step.  However, I have to wait for the step to completely execute first. This can cause a delay of several seconds for a complicated query, and if I'm adding several steps in sequence, this adds up.  Other commands on the query step are available without waiting, but I'd like Rename to be included in those commands.

 

I know I can skip the wait by using Advanced Editor, but then I have to edit the name in multiple locations to ensure that I don't break the query.
